English Frances Italian Русский/Russian

Руководство для начинающих

Руководство для начинающих

kX драйвер был разработан для звуковых плат, основанных на чипах Emu10k1 и Emu10k2, например, таких как SBLive, Audigy и других плат. Эти Emu10kx чипы фактически являются цифровыми сигнальными процессорами (DSP). Если Вы откроете окно DSP kX Драйвера, Вы увидите, что фактически можете редактировать свойства и поведение чипа вашей звуковой платы, изменяя маршрутизации, загружая и редактируя эффекты и так далее.

Чтобы объяснять это более подробно, давайте сначала посмотрим на основные объекты kX окна DSP. Лучший способ описать это состоит в том, чтобы представить окно DSP с объектами как своего рода стойку, с различными устройствами ввода и вывода и устройствами эффектов, соединенными между собой (очень высокого качества) аудио кабелями (представьте себе стойку эффектов профессионального гитариста, включающей в себя ламповый усилитель, микшер, ревер, хорус, дисторшн, квакушку и т.д.). "устройства", которые Вы видите в окне kX DSP, имеют входы (слева) или выходы (справа) или и то и другое, и связаны друг с другом виртуальными аудио кабелями (синие линии).

Кроме различных эффектов, мы видим 4 устройства "ввода - вывода" в окне DSP. Это - FXbus (два, если у вас 10k2 плата), Prolog, Epilog и (x)Routing . Давайте исследуем эти четыре объекта более подробно, затем взглянем на ASIO маршрутизацию с кратким обзором окна kX Routing.

1. FXBus

FXbus имеет 16 выходов (или 32 для 10k2 плат, и 64, если загружен дополнительный 'FXBus2' эффект) для аудио потоков, сгенерированных программным обеспечением, запущенным на вашем PC (типа mp3 плейера, звук из WaveTable MIDI синтезатора, или из одного из выходов ASIO). Все аудио данные, которые сгенерируются, будут находиться в этом устройстве.

2. Prolog

Пролог выводит любые аудио данные, поступающие в ваш PC СНАРУЖИ, такие как линейный вход (сигнал с подключенной гитары), цифровой оптическй вход на LiveDrive, или цифровой вход CD (CDSPDIF) , разъем которого находится непосредственно на плате. Существует один специальный выход Пролога, который является причиной большого замешательства среди новых пользователей kX драйвера, - это выход AC97.

10k1 и 10k2 - это цифровые микросхемы, поэтому они не могут непосредственно принять аналоговый входной сигнал. На Live! (Audigy) платах есть другой чип, отвечающий за это - AC97 кодер-декодер (кодек). Этот чип подключен ко всем аналоговым входам на Live! платах (за исключением входов LiveDrive), микширует их, и посылает в Emu10kX. Этот кодек отвечает за линейный и микрофонный входы на плате и, среди прочего, за аналоговый вход CD (не путать с цифровым CD). Вы можете управлять этим кодеком на вкладке AC97 окна kX микшера, помня, что линия AC97 на Прологе - это то, где появляются аудио данные с аналоговых входов (в прологе вы также можете найти все остальные входы, расположенные на звуковой плате и на LiveDrive). Обратите внимание, что LiveDrive использует высококачественный аналого-цифровой преобразователь (ADC), который во многом превосходит AC97 кодек (E-mu APS и Audigy2 Platinum Ex вообще не имеют AC97 кодеков).

3. Epilog

Эпилог - это устройство, куда в конечном счете выводятся все данные. Он состоит из 2 частей; "реальные" ('физические') выходы и "запись" (например, ASIO) выходы. Реальные выходы просто отражают все физические выходы (и аналоговые и цифровые) на чипе Emu10kX. Обратите внимание, что чип Emu10kX реально поддерживает 4 цифровых стерео выхода (да, оригинальный Live!, и даже 512 PCI и все 7.1 платы). Чтобы использовать в своих целях эту возможность, не используя LiveDrive, можно использовать "AUD_EXT" разъемы, находящиеся на большинстве 10kx плат (хотя, немного специального знания и опыта все же не помешает).

На большинстве 10kX плат, "передний" аналоговый выход сгенерирован AC97 кодеком, в то время как тыловой канал проходит через I2S кодек. По этой причине (I2S выход вообще превосходит AC97 выход), kX драйвер меняет 'передние' и 'тыловые' колонки по умолчанию. Обратите внимание, что в случае Audigy и Audigy2 плат, I2S кодек используется для выхода на 'Передние' колонки, а AC97 кодек используется для записи только от встроенных аналоговых разъемов. Однако, все же рекомендуется менять передние и тыловые колонки, потому что выходной сигнал от AC97 кодека (даже приглушенный) все еще связан с 'Передним' выходом платы (и это воздействует на качество звука).

Лучший способ понять все это и использовать в своих интересах состоит в том, чтобы не смотреть на 10k1 и 10k2 платы как на аудио платы с передними и тыловыми выходами и все, а просто как на чип с 4 каналами стерео выхода (которыми они фактически и являются). Никто не говорит вам, что вы ДОЛЖНЫ использовать "зеленый" разъем для подключения передних динамиков; вы можете точно также использовать его для выхода на наушники, и использовать "черный" (тыловой) разъем как выход на аудио систему (в клубе, используйте зеленый разъем для наушников, черный вставляйте в аудио и, теперь вы диджей с 2 отдельными звуковыми каналами). Зачем использовать черный разъем для аудио системы? Это просто - черный (тыловой) канал использует I2S кодек, и таким образом производит лучший звук ..., ну и аудитория заслуживает лучшего :-).

Вторая часть Эпилога - это часть с выходами записи. Эти выходы (RecL/R и 16 ASIO каналов записи) используются для записи аудиопотоков на ваш PC. Если, например, вы выведите аудиопотоки на RecL/R порты, Вы сможете записать аудио на жесткий диск, используя стандартную программу "Звукозапись". Вы также можете использовать 16 ASIO каналов для записи данных при помощи, например, программы Cubase, или использовать ASIO каналы, чтобы подать данные в процессоры эффектов SpinAudio/DSound. Таким образом, порты эпилога в основном являются входящими соединениями к вашим программам (в противоположность FXbus, который является выходом из ваших программ).

4. Routing

Возвращаясь назад к воображаемой "стойке", вам должно быть уже ясно, что из себя представляет устройство Routing (маршрутизатор). Это - центральная часть микшера. Устройство Routing микширует сигналы с выходов FXBus и пролога и отправляет их на входы эпилога, используя настройки панели управления kX Микшера (то есть фэйдеры). Имеются также две группы специальных входов FX, которые используются для добавления специальных эффектов к звуку. Однако обычно, эти два FX посыла микшируются только с реальными выходами, не затрагивая каналы записи. Обратите внимание, что вы можете регулировать уровень записи с добавлением эффектов на вкладке 'Запись' окна kX Микшера.

НО (и в этом все преимущество kX), вы совершенно не обязаны использовать все объекты по умолчанию! Вы можете настроить объекты и эффекты DSP так, как вам хочется, или использовать несколько разных настроек, в зависимости от ваших потребностей, которые вы можете сохранять и загружать. Например, подключите гитару во вход LineIn2 вашего LiveDrive. Очистите окно DSP и загрузите только объекты Prolog и Epilog (найдете в разделе "Стандартные" в меню вставки эффектов). Соедините выход LineIn2 объекта Prolog с передними колонками (Analog Front) объекта Epilog, получилось прямое соединение. Протяните другую 'линию' от того же выхода LineIn2 ко входу RecL/R объекта Epilog, и теперь вы можете играть на гитаре и записывать ее в масштабе реального времени. Возможно, вы захотите добавить эквалайзер или компрессор между прологом и эпилогом - хорошая идея!

5. ASIO Routing

ASIO - название драйвера "API" (аппаратно-программный интерфейс), разработанного фирмой Steinberg с целью позволить драйверам достичь более низкого времени ожидания. Это означает, что вы можете получить на своих компьютерах процесс обработки аудио данных (например, аудиосигнал с некоторой программы на PC, или входной сигнал с вашей звуковой платы и выход на вашу звуковую систему), всё - с задержкой (необходимой для расчётов) столь же низкой, как почти в реальном масштабе времени. Таким образом, при игре на подключенной в линию гитаре, вы можете обрабатывать звук различными эффектами почти в реальном масштабе времени.

kX ASIO драйвер поддерживает прохождение аудио потоков через 16 каналов входа и выхода со временем ожидания в 2.66 ms на быстрой и хорошо-настроенной системе, как для записи, так и для воспроизведения.

ASIO Входы

Мы уже объясняли, где находятся ASIO входы - это 16 последних каналов на Эпилоге, и вы можете использовать входы ASIO в любом приложении, контролировать их, добавлять эффекты, производить запись на жесткий диск, или выводить на те же самые ASIO драйвера - к любому другому выходу, но тогда вы потеряете преимущество низкого времени ожидания, которое является главной особенностью ASIO драйвера.

ASIO Выходы

У вас есть 16 ASIO выходов. По умолчанию, эти 16 каналов отображены один к одному в объекте FXBus, так, 1-ый канал ASIO выхода соответствует 1-му каналу FXBus (фактически - это FXBus0). Итак, возвращаясь к нашим гитарным экспериментам в DSP, соедините LineIn2 на Прологе с каналами ASIO записи, скажем, с последними двумя (они предложены только потому, что есть маленькая проблема с платами SB006x, которые неспособны использовать 2-ой и 3-ий ASIO каналы - смотрите дополнительную информацию в разделе FAQ). Теперь сигнал с вашей гитары идет на 2 последних ASIO входа. Запустите SpinAudio ASIO FX Processor, чтобы добавить некоторые эффекты - входной сигнал с гитары, проходя через программу, будет на последних двух ASIO каналах. Вернемся к воображаемой стойке, теперь вы должны вернуть сигнал, выходящий из SpinAudio в DSP, чтобы пустить его на реальный выход (как, например, в нашем случае на "фронтальные колонки + рекордер "). Сигнал из из программы выходит на первые 2 ASIO канала, который мы получаем на первых 2 выходах объекта FXBus. Теперь, протяните виртуальные кабели от первых двух каналов объекта FXBus к передним колонкам объекта Epilog в окне DSP (и снова к рекордеру, или к другому ASIO входу). Вы можете делать столько соединений, сколько вам захочется, но имеете в виду, что каждое "соединение" к и от DSP, используя ASIO входы и выходы, добавляет время ожидания (обратите внимание, что соединения в kX DSP вообще не затрагивают время ожидания - вы можете иметь их столько, сколько хотите). Добавьте и включите эффекты в SpinAudio; теперь поиграйте на гитаре; поздравляю, вы только что завершили вашу первую ASIO маршрутизацию с использованием разных эффектов! :-)

6. Окно kX Router

Новые пользователи иногда находят окно kX Router запутывающим, частично потому что оно не имеет никакого отношения к объекту Routing окна DSP, и все там связано с объектом FXBus. Если вы посмотрите на окно маршрутизации, вы увидите, что все выходы, генерируемые программным обеспечением, располагаются слева в виде раскрывающегося дерева. Там вы увидите Wave 0/1, 4/5, 6/7 и 8/9 - они соответствуют 4 устройствам волнового выхода, шины 4/5, 6/7 и 8/9 - это, по существу, каналы DirectSound/AC3, передние/тыловые колонки и центр/субвуфер скопированные с шины 0/1, являющейся "стандартным" волновым выходом. Также, в этом списке вы найдете выходы AC3 (и DirectSound, как упомянуто выше), два синтезатора и выходы ASIO.

Как все это касается объекта FXBus?

Хорошо, объект FXBus имеет свою собственную внутреннюю маршрутизацию/микширование, и все программные выходы направляются к одному из выходов FXBus. Обычно, стерео пара wave 0/1 направлена на каналы 0 и 1 (и также на каналы 13 и 14 для добавления эффектов). Выходы ASIO обычно отображаются один к одному в объекте FXBus (канал ASIO 1 = FXBus 1), Синтезатор выходит на каналы FXBus 2 и 3, и т.д., и т.д. Вы можете изменить любой из этих параметров, но значения по умолчанию обычно прекрасно подходят для большинства целей, примером специальной установки было бы добавление множителя, для микширования эффектов с определенными выходами (подобно стандартному Реверу/Хорусу на каналах 13/14).

Итак: наш краткий обзор работы kX и ASIO подошел к концу - удачи вам с драйверами и экспериментами в DSP :-) - это лучший способ учиться!

-- написано Мата Хари
-- (незначительные исправления kX Team)
Copyright © kX Project, 2001-2015. Все права защищены . Права и условия использования Благодарности
Top

[adv] nexgard 60-121 lbs . actiforum.com . Stamp duty calculator . Gala moderator
Яндекс.Метрика
Рейтинг@Mail.ru